About the Opportunity

We’re looking for a curious, motivated HR intern to support our team from November onwards. This internship is a great opportunity to gain hands-on experience in Human Resources within an international environment and to apply what you are learning in your studies.

What you’ll do:

  • Support HR colleagues in recruitment processes (e.g. job postings, screening CVs, interview scheduling, candidate communication)
  • Assist with onboarding and offboarding and general employee lifecycle administration
  • Help prepare HR presentations and documentation, ensuring data quality and accuracy
  • Contributing to employee engagement, trainings and satisfaction initiatives
  • Update HR sites and reports, helping to improve processes and tools
  • Play an active role at university fairs and campus events, representing Zurich Duo and supporting employer branding and early talent attraction
  • Work closely and effectively with Internal Communications and other teams, ensuring smooth collaboration and alignment on HR initiatives

What you’ll bring

  • Current enrolment in a Bachelor’s or Master’s programme in Psychology, Labor Relations, or a related field
  • Strong interest in Human Resources (e.g. talent acquisition, employee experience…)
  • Fluent in English, written and spoken. Any additional language is a strong plus
  • Available to work part-time from November at the office in Barcelona, preferably for a 6-month internship
  • Motivated, independent and communicative attitude, with a strong willingness to learn

What’s in it for you

  • Practical experience in HR within a global, multicultural environment
  • Supportive team culture that encourages learning, collaboration and growth
  • Modern office environment with free water and coffee, and access to a terrace for breaks
  • Competitive internship stipend (details depend on location) and flexible working arrangements.
